His first album featured a recording of the Beatles' "With a Little Help from My Friends", which brought him to near-instant stardom. The song reached number one in the UK in 1968, became a staple of his many live shows (Woodstock and the Isle of Wight in 1969, the Party at the Palace in 2002) and was also known as the theme song for the late 1980s American TV series The Wonder Years. He continued his success with his second album, which included a second Beatles song: "She Came In Through the Bathroom Window". A hastily thrown together 1970 US tour led to the live double-album Mad Dogs & Englishmen, which featured an all-star band organized by Leon Russell. His 1974 recording of "You Are So Beautiful" reached number five in the US, and became his signature song. Cocker's best selling song was the US number one "Up Where We Belong", a duet with Jennifer Warnes that earned a 1983 Grammy Award. He released a total of 22 studio albums over a 43-year recording career.
In 1993, Cocker was nominated for the Brit Award for Best British Male. He was awarded a bronze Sheffield Legends plaque in his hometown in 2007, and received an OBE the following year for services to music. Cocker was ranked number 97 on Rolling Stone's 100 greatest singers list.

The lyrics of Joe Cocker's "Now That You're Gone" is a melancholy and emotional portrayal of a lost love, reminiscing about the past and wondering what went wrong. The song starts with the singer's reflection on how much his partner has changed since they first met, wondering if she is still the same person he fell in love with. He notes how far they've come in this world, but questions where they're going, alluding to the fact that their relationship might have lost its direction.
The chorus, "Why did you go away, leaving me alone? There's nothing left to say, now that you're gone," expresses the pain of heartbreak and the inability to move on. The repetitive line, "Now that you're gone - now that you're gone," emphasizes the finality of the separation and the void it has left in the singer's life. The second verse talks about how his partner has become a different person, someone who walks the streets and runs wild. The singer wonders if life has changed so much that his former love doesn't even want to remember the happy times they shared together.
Overall, "Now That You're Gone" captures the sense of loss that comes with a broken relationship. It highlights the bittersweet feelings of remembering the past, acknowledging the present, and questioning what the future holds.
